Job Description What is the opportunity? RBC Capital Markets Global Investment Banking is seeking a Vice President to join the Power, Utilities and Infrastructure team in Toronto. This position is a unique opportunity to broaden your financial skillset and gain exposure to an evolving industry. This role is intended for individuals who wish to build a long-term career in Investment Banking with a market leading franchise and global platform. What will you do? Evaluate and analyze the financial needs of clients, including building new and manipulating existing financial models Lead M&A and financing transaction structuring and execution, including coordinating due diligence, preparing and reviewing analysis and presenting recommendations to clients and colleagues Assist in generating pitch ideas, conducting market and financial research and leading development of analysis and presentations Closely monitors regulatory and sector themes to identify potential changes to our clients’ businesses Secondary coverage for key power, utility, and infrastructure fund clients Evaluate capital structure alternatives and provide recommendations based on underlying business characteristics Attend and participate in in-person meetings with clients and prospective clients, site visits, and diligence and drafting sessions Train, mentor, and supervise analysts and associates on day-to-day deliverables Collaborate with colleagues across corporate and investment banking coverage and product groups to deliver holistic financing solutions What do you need to succeed? 5-7 years of experience in investment banking, leveraged finance, private equity, equity research, corporate development, or accounting University degree, preferably with a focus on Finance, Accounting or Engineering A desire to learn and a team-oriented mindset A clearly defined interest in investment banking and financial markets, and strong knowledge of market structure and themes Strong computer skills, including high proficiency with Microsoft Excel and PowerPoint Quantitative, analytical, and financial modeling skills Adept written and verbal communication, data visualization and problem-solving skills Ability to work well under pressure with multiple deadlines while maintaining careful attention to detail Flexibility in schedule to meet client deadlines Leadership skillset and desire to make meaningful contributions in a fast-paced, team environment Prior work experience in or covering the power or utility sector, understanding of key power and utility industry concepts (e.g. revenue and cost frameworks, capital structure), CFA, CPA, P.Eng or other relevant professional designations are considered an asset but not a requirement What’s in it for you?
